Some Information about Aubrey.
Aubrey is a city in Denton County, Texas, United States. The population was 2,595 at the 2010 census.
As of 2009 Starr’s Service Station, located off Sherman Drive and across the street from the Ever After chapel, serves as a social center for Aubrey.
Braswell High School of the Denton Independent School District is south of Aubrey and serves some areas with “Aubrey, Texas” addresses; they are not in the Aubrey city limits.
Aubrey is located at 33°18′26″N 96°59′2″W (33.307148, -96.983970). It is 12 miles (19 km) north of Denton.
According to the United States Census Bureau, the city has a total area of 2.6 square miles (6.8 km2), of which 2.6 square miles (6.7 km2) is land and 0.019 square miles (0.05 km2), or 0.73%, is water.
As of the census of 2000, there were 1,500 people, 559 households, and 418 families residing in the city. The population density was 720.4 people per square mile (278.4/km²). There were 597 housing units at an average density of 286.7 per square mile (110.8/km²). The racial makeup of the city was 92.5% White, 0.5% African American, 0.7% Native American, 0.5% Asian, 4.7% some other race, and 1.1% from two or more races. Hispanic or Latino of any race were 6.7% of the population.
In the city, the population was spread out with 29.3% under the age of 18, 8.7% from 18 to 24, 33.3% from 25 to 44, 19.7% from 45 to 64, and 9.1% who were 65 years of age or older. The median age was 31 years. For every 100 females age 18 and over, there were 96.8 males.
